Wheel Good Insurance Starts With State Farm
Your motorcycle coverage from State Farm may help when the unexpected happens like bodily injury to yourself because of an accident with an uninsured, damage to someone else's property when riding your motorcycle, bodily injury to someone else when riding your motorcycle, and more. But that's not all! There are also options available for support with trip interruption expenses.
